4,7-Dibromo-2,1,3-benzoselenadiazole is an organic semiconductor building block built around a benzoselenadiazole core carrying two bromine atoms at the 4 and 7 positions. In materials science laboratories, this compound serves as an electron-accepting unit that is ready to be polymerized or coupled in order to construct donor-acceptor systems. The two symmetrically placed bromo groups make it an ideal bifunctional monomer for cross-coupling reactions such as Stille, Suzuki, and direct C-H coupling, allowing researchers to assemble conjugated polymers with controlled, regularly repeating chain structures.
The key characteristic that leads researchers to select this material is the presence of a selenium atom in place of the sulfur found in the more common benzothiadiazole framework. The selenium atom is larger and more easily polarized, and it contributes stronger intermolecular interactions, so the resulting polymers tend to display a narrower band gap, absorption shifted toward longer wavelengths, and denser chain packing within thin films. These properties are highly sought after in organic solar cell and near-infrared detector research. The benzoselenadiazole core also retains the electron-deficient character needed for a reliable acceptor unit.

Laboratory Applications
- Donor-acceptor copolymer synthesis: the symmetric dibromo substitution provides two reliable coupling sites, letting researchers alternate this acceptor unit with donor comonomers in a regular, repeating chain sequence.
- Stille cross-coupling: the aryl bromide positions react cleanly with organostannane partners, making this a standard monomer for building extended conjugated backbones under palladium catalysis.
- Suzuki cross-coupling: the same bromo groups pair with boronic acids and esters, giving materials chemists an alternative route to conjugated polymers and defined small-molecule segments.
- Direct C-H coupling polymerization: the compound can be coupled without prior stannylation or borylation, reducing synthetic steps for laboratories developing more streamlined polymer preparation routes.
- Organic solar cell and near-infrared detector materials research: the selenium-containing core narrows the band gap and red-shifts absorption, supporting devices that must harvest longer-wavelength light.

Handling and Storage
Store the container tightly closed in a cool, dry, and well-ventilated area, away from direct sunlight, heat sources, and incompatible chemicals. Amber glass bottles or the original manufacturer container are suitable, and transferring under an inert atmosphere is advisable when the material will be used in moisture-sensitive cross-coupling reactions. Handle the compound inside a fume hood using gloves, safety glasses, and a laboratory coat, and avoid generating or inhaling dust during weighing. Keep the container clearly labelled, and always consult the manufacturer's safety data sheet before use and disposal.
